The Michigan Electronic Library (MEL) today. (http://mel.org)
Notes:
MEL is a flat file of URLs that are selected by a team of about a dozen librarians. They are selected for their relevance to the staff and users of libraries of all types around the state. It only includes free sites.
This section (POINT TO THE BROWSE SECTION) is the heart of MEL: it leads to about 30,000 sites organized by topic area.
Each selector is also supposed to check for 404s and other flawed links in his or her area of responsibility, but that is, or at least it was during my term there, a fairly hit or miss proposition.

This is a link to the Serials, Periodicals and Newspapers database, a union list of serials held by MI libraries. SPAN was named after the Mackinaw Bridge that connects the upper and lower peninsulas of the state.
